Mani Ratnam, who recently helmed Thug Life featuring Kamal Haasan, is said to be joining forces with Vijay Sethupathi and Rukmini Vasanth for his upcoming
project. If the rumors hold true, this collaboration will reunite the director with the actor after their 2018 action movie, Chekka Chivantha Vaanam.

Should the information be accurate, it will be Vijay Sethupathi's second collaboration with Rukmini Vasanth. The duo recently teamed up for the film Ace, which marked Rukmini Vasanth's debut in Tamil cinema. Earlier, there were rumors suggesting that Mani Ratnam was bringing in Dhruv Vikram along with Rukmini for his next venture. According to reports, the film is a romantic narrative. About Rukmini Vasanth And Vijay Sethupathi's Projects
In Tamil cinema, Rukmini Vasanth appeared alongside Sivakarthikeyan in AR Murugadoss' Madharaasi. Her most recent appearance was in Kantara: Chapter 1, where she starred with Rishab Shetty. Currently, she is engaged in the filming of Jr NTR’s NTR 31.
Vijay Sethupathi was last featured in Thalaivan Thalaivii alongside Nithya Menen. He is set to appear in Mysskin's Train and an unnamed project with Puri Jagannadh. Additionally, he is hosting the 9th season of Bigg Boss Tamil.
Mani Ratnam’s Thug Life premiered in theaters on June 5 and received a lukewarm reception from viewers. This film marked the director's collaboration with veteran actor Kamal Haasan 38 years after their film Nayakan. Featuring a star-studded cast that includes Silambarasan, Trisha, Ashok Selvan, Nasser, and others, the film is currently available for streaming on Netflix. Mani Ratnam's Nayakan has been re-released in theaters to celebrate Kamal Haasan's birthday.
